Whales and Dolphins by Mark Carwardine

Presenting an introductory guide to 96 species of whale, dolphin and porpoise, this book serves as a companion for whale-watching trips throughout the world. Each species is illustrated with a photograph and includes information on size, geographical distribution and diet. It also contains information on whether the species is under threat.
Mark Cawardine is a zoologist, writer, photographer, consultant and broadcaster with a special interest in marine wildlife. He has written more than 40 books, including several bestsellers, and presents Nature and a wide variety of other natural history programmes on BBC Radio 4. A keen diver for many years, he leads shark and whale-watching holidays to many parts of the world and is an ardent supporter of several wildlife conservation organisations.
